How to Make One Pan Balsamic Chicken
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Preheat Your Oven
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Spray a large baking dish or sheet pan with nonstick cooking spray.
Step 2: Prepare the Marinade
In a small bowl, combine balsamic vinegar, olive oil, soy sauce, minced garlic, and brown sugar. Whisk until well blended.
Step 3: Marinate the Chicken
Place the chicken breasts in a zip-top bag or shallow dish. Pour half of the marinade over them. Seal or cover and let marinate for at least 15 minutes.
Step 4: Arrange Vegetables
While the chicken marinates, chop your chosen vegetables into bite-sized pieces. Spread them evenly on the prepared baking pan.
Step 5: Combine Everything
Remove chicken from marinade and place on top of vegetables in the baking pan. Drizzle remaining marinade over everything.
Step 6: Bake Until Done
Bake in preheated oven for about 25–30 minutes or until chicken reaches an internal temperature of at least 165°F (75°C). Transfer to plates and drizzle with sauce for the perfect finishing touch.

Make Ahead and Storage
- Make Ahead: You can marinate the chicken in balsamic vinegar, garlic, and herbs up to 24 hours in advance. This enhances the flavor and saves time on cooking day. Store the marinated chicken in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
- Storing: Leftover One Pan Balsamic Chicken can be stored in an airtight container for up to 3 days in the refrigerator. For longer storage, freeze it for up to 2 months. Make sure to label your containers with dates for easy tracking.
- Reheating: To reheat, place the chicken in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 15-20 minutes or until heated through. Alternatively, you can microwave it on medium power for 2-3 minutes, stirring halfway through to maintain moisture.

Don’t Overcrowd the Pan
When making One Pan Balsamic Chicken, avoid overcrowding the pan. If too many ingredients are crammed together, they will steam rather than brown properly. This can lead to a mushy texture instead of the desirable caramelization. To achieve that perfect golden color and rich flavor, cook in batches if necessary. Ensuring adequate space between ingredients allows heat to circulate evenly, resulting in a beautifully cooked dish.

Monitor Cooking Time
Pay close attention to cooking time when preparing One Pan Balsamic Chicken. Overcooking can lead to dry chicken breasts that lack flavor and tenderness. Generally, chicken should be cooked until it re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C). Using a meat thermometer is an excellent way to ensure doneness without guessing. Remove the chicken from heat once it’s done and allow it to rest for a few minutes before slicing; this helps retain moisture.

One Pan Balsamic Chicken
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Category: Main
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
Description
One Pan Balsamic Chicken is a flavorful and easy dish that brings together juicy chicken breasts and vibrant vegetables, all cooked in a single pan for minimal cleanup. This recipe features a tangy marinade made from high-quality balsamic vinegar, garlic, and soy sauce, creating an irresistible glaze that enhances the dish’s taste. Perfect for busy weeknights or casual gatherings, this one-pan wonder can be customized with your favorite seasonal veggies, making every meal a delightful experience. With just 30 minutes from preparation to table, you’ll enjoy a wholesome meal that’s sure to impress family and friends alike.
Ingredients
- 3–4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 2 cloves fresh garlic
- 1/2 cup balsamic vinegar
- 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
- Seasonal vegetables (bell peppers, broccoli)
- 2 tablespoons low-sodium soy sauce
- 1 tablespoon brown sugar
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C) and spray a large baking dish with nonstick cooking spray.
- In a bowl, whisk together balsamic vinegar, olive oil, soy sauce, minced garlic, and brown sugar to create the marinade.
- Marinate the chicken in half of the mixture for at least 15 minutes.
- Chop vegetables and spread them evenly on the prepared baking pan.
- Place marinated chicken on top of the vegetables and drizzle with remaining marinade.
- Bake for 25-30 minutes until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C).
